Aquanate GLT is a naturally derived anionic surfactant produced from L-glutamic acid, a naturally occurring amino acid, and lauric acid. It is a mild surfactant that is readily biodegradable and can be used as the primary or secondary surfactant in a detergent system. Aquanate GLT produces excellent foam and detergency. This product is suitable for a variety of home care applications such as mild dish soap, hand soaps, surface care and laundry products. Stable between a pH of 4.0-10.0 view less

EMPILAN® 2502 / MB is coconut diethanolamide produced by the direct amidation of vegetable oil and it therefore contains residual glycerol. The vegetable oil from which it is derived is sourced according to the Mass Balance rules set by the RSPO*. This product is a very good foam-boosting/stabilising agent when used in conjunction with anionic surfactants, such as lauryl sulphates and lauryl ether sulphates. It also provides an efficient means of increasing the viscosity of liquid formulations and can be used to pre-solubilise oils and perfumes during formulation.
This makes it an ideal co-surfactant for laundry products (liquid and powder) and other detergent products such as dish-wash liquids. view less

EMPICOL® XHL 300 is a mixture of readily biodegradable anionic, non-ionic surfactants, soap and additives. It is a concentrated detergent specifically developed for rapid production of unbuilt laundry liquids. It contains a blend of anionic and nonionic surfactants, plus soap, anti redeposition aid, complexing agent and anti-foaming agent and can be readily diluted. A range of laundry products can therefore be manufactured by the addition of perfumes, dyes, optical brighteners and preservatives. view less

NANSA® PC 38/F is an aqueous solution of a potassium fatty acid soap. Fatty acid soaps are commonly used surfactants for their cleaning and degreasing properties, but they can also help to control foam, for example in laundry liquids for automatic machine wash and other detergents, reducing the requirement to add additional de-foaming agents. They are also frequently used in personal care products and this product is ideal for use in liquid formulations, such as hand soaps for dispensers, shower and bath products, etc.
Soaps are predominantly manufactured from vegetable oil raw materials and so are often perceived as natural or naturally derived surfactants. Potassium soaps provide the advantage of increased solubility over sodium salts. view less
